Looking to purchase a decent hang on stand this year that I can stay mobile with and put up and take down every hunt. Decided to go with the xop sticks but I'm still up in the air on which stand to buy. Thoughts?

I have 2 mobile stands. I use a old 8.5lb LW Assault and a XOP Silver. The XOP is very similar to a LW Alpha. In my opinion it is hard to beat the XOP and LW stands, the cast platform is very solid and quiet and they are very adjustable for crooked trees.

I have the LW Alpha and like it. It has all the adjustment capabilities as the higher priced LWs. Only problem the Microlite has is lack of adjustments if you get a tree that is leaning one way or another.
